Vellum features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    Vellum offers a clean and intuitive design interface that makes it easy for authors to format and publish their ebooks without a steep learning curve.
  • High-Quality Output
    The software produces professional-looking ebooks with elegant formatting and styling, which enhances the appearance of the published work.
  • Multi-format Support
    Vellum allows users to create ebooks in multiple formats, such as ePub and Kindle, enabling distribution across various platforms like Amazon KDP, Apple Books, and more.
  • Customizable Styles
    Authors can customize the look of their ebooks with various styles and layout options to suit their personal tastes and branding.
  • Time-Saving Features
    Automated features like chapter creation and page break insertion save authors time compared to manual formatting.

Possible disadvantages of Vellum

  • Mac-Only Software
    Vellum is only available for macOS, which limits access for authors who use Windows or other operating systems.
  • High Cost
    The one-time purchase cost of Vellum can be high for independent authors, especially for those who only plan to publish a few books.
  • Limited Editing Tools
    Vellum is primarily a formatting tool and offers limited text editing capabilities, which means users may need other software for comprehensive editing.
  • No Built-in Distribution
    While Vellum facilitates the creation of ebooks, it does not provide built-in distribution or publishing services, requiring authors to handle this separately.
  • Internet Activation Required
    Users need to have an internet connection for software activation and certain updates, which might be inconvenient if connectivity is an issue.
